Latest Patents

Kasunori Sato holds a patent for a "Residual stress improving method for members in reactor pressure vessel." This invention involves a low-temperature water tank that supplies cold water jets to specific areas within a reactor pressure vessel. The method applies thermal shock to improve the residual stress of the core shroud, enhancing the overall integrity of the reactor.
